Windsurf
Підключіть API AstroWay до Windsurf через MCP. Сервер використовує асистент Cascade.
Передумови
Section titled “Передумови”Отримайте API-ключ у дашборді. Для безкоштовного тестування використовуйте sandbox-ключ aw_test_* — він не списує кредити.
Підключення
Section titled “Підключення”Відредагуйте ~/.codeium/windsurf/mcp_config.json; також доступно через Settings → Cascade → MCP. Зверніть увагу: для віддаленого сервера Windsurf використовує ключ serverUrl (не url). Вставте один із блоків нижче і перезапустіть Windsurf.
Hosted (HTTP) — без встановлення, автентифікація через Bearer-токен:
{"mcpServers": { "astroway": { "serverUrl": "https://mcp.astroway.info/mcp", "headers": { "Authorization": "Bearer aw_live_YOUR_KEY" } }}}Stdio (npx) — локальний підпроцес, автентифікація через env-змінну, працює офлайн:
{"mcpServers": { "astroway": { "command": "npx", "args": ["-y", "@astroway/mcp"], "env": { "ASTROWAY_API_KEY": "aw_live_YOUR_KEY" } }}}Перевірка
Section titled “Перевірка”У Cascade напишіть: «Перелічи інструменти Astroway» — або попросіть викликати безкоштовний reference-інструмент, наприклад отримати список знаків зодіаку. Якщо у відповідь приходить результат, підключення працює.
Усунення проблем
Section titled “Усунення проблем”- 401 / invalid key — переконайтеся, що ключ має префікс
aw_live_*абоaw_test_*і не відкликаний. Перевірити можна в дашборді. - Інструменти не з’являються — повністю перезапустіть Windsurf і перевірте шлях
~/.codeium/windsurf/mcp_config.json(для hosted — ключserverUrl). - Помилки валідації
-32602(для stdio) — оновіть пакет:npm i @astroway/mcp@latest. Схеми перегенеровуються з актуальної специфікації.
Усі клієнти — Налаштування агента.